Using the Microsoft Common Spell API

An introduction to using the Microsoft CSAPI.
/* CSAPI.H - API entry header file for CSAPI 
*
* See Csapi.Doc for details on the CSAPI.
* Note that the double slash comment // should not be used in this file
*  since THINK_C does not support this format.
*/

/************************** Structure Typedefs *************/

typedef WORD SEC;  /* Spell Error Code.  Low byte for major code, High byte for minor.*/

typedef struct SpellInputBuffer
{
    unsigned short       cch;        /* Total characters in buffer area  */
    unsigned short       cMdr;       /* Count of MDR's specified in lrgMdr */
    unsigned short       cUdr;       /* Should not reference Exclusion UDR's. 
	                                     Count of UDR's specified in lrgUdr */
	unsigned short       wSpellState; /* State relative to previous SpellCheck() call */
    CHAR       FAR       *lrgch;     /* ptr to buf area of text to be spell checked */
    MDR        FAR       *lrgMdr;    /* List of main dicts to use when spelling the buffer */
    UDR        FAR       *lrgUdr;    /* Should not reference Exclusion UDR's. 
	                                     List of user dicts to use when spelling the buffer */
} SIB;
typedef SIB FAR * LPSIB;

typedef struct SpellReturnBuffer
{
	/* These fields are set by the SpellCheck() function */
    /* reference word in error or flagged into SIB. */
    unsigned short       ichError;   /*position in the SIB */
    unsigned short       cchError;   /*Length of error "word" in SIB.*/

    /* These fields are set by the SpellCheck() function. */
    SCRS                 scrs;       /*spell check return status. Set by SC()*/
    unsigned short       csz;        /*count of sz's put in buffer. Set by SC*/
    unsigned short       cchMac;     /* Current total of chars in buffer. */


	/* These fields MUST be set by the app, NULL pointers are invalid */
    unsigned short       cch;        /* total space in lrgch.  Set by App. */
    CHAR     FAR         *lrgsz;     /* ptr to alternatives.  
                                        format: word\0word\0...word\0\0*/
    BYTE     FAR         *lrgbRating;/* ptr to Rating value for each sugg. returned.
										Parallel to lrgsz array.  Allocated by App.*/
    unsigned short       cbRate;     /* Number of elements in lrgbRating.
	                                    Set by App. lrgbRating must be this long.*/
} SRB;
typedef SRB FAR * LPSRB;

/* Flag values for SpellState field in Sib. */
#define fssIsContinued            0x0001 
    /* Call is continuing from where last call returned.  Must be cleared
       for first call into SpellCheck(). 
    */

#define fssStartsSentence         0x0002
   /* First word in buffer is known to be start of 
      sentence/paragraph/document.  This is only used if the 
      fSibIsContinued bit is not set.  It should not be needed if the 
      fSibIsContinued bit is being used.  If this bit is set during a 
      suggestion request, suggestions will be capitalized. 
   */

#define fssIsEditedChange         0x0004
   /* The run of text represented in the SIB is a change from either
      a change pair (change always or change once) edit, or from a
      user specified change, possibly from a suggestion list presented 
      to the user.  This text should be checked for repeat word
      problems, and possibly sentence status, but should not be subject
      to subsequent spell verification or change pair substitutions.  
      Note that if an app is not using the fSibIsContinued support, 
      they do not need to pass in these edited changes, thus bypassing 
      the potential problem, and working faster.
   */

#define fssNoStateInfo            0x0000
   /* App is responsible for checking for all repeat word and sentence 
	  punctuation, and avoiding processing loops such as change always 
	  can=can can.
   */
/* End of Sib Spell State flag definitions. */


/* Spell Check return status identifiers */
#define scrsNoErrors                      0  /* All buffer processed. */
#define scrsUnknownInputWord              1  /* Unknown word. */
#define scrsReturningChangeAlways         2  /* Returning a Change Always word in SRB. */
#define scrsReturningChangeOnce           3  /* Returning a Change Once word in SRB. */
#define scrsInvalidHyphenation            4  /* Error in hyphenation point.*/
#define scrsErrorCapitalization           5  /* Cap pattern not valid. */
#define scrsWordConsideredAbbreviation    6  /* Word is considered an abbreviation. */
#define scrsHyphChangesSpelling           7  /* Word changes spelling when not hyphenated. */
#define scrsNoMoreSuggestions             8  /* All methods used. */
#define scrsMoreInfoThanBufferCouldHold   9  /* More return data than fit in buffer */
#define scrsNoSentenceStartCap           10  /* Start of sentence was not capitalized. */
#define scrsRepeatWord                   11  /* Repeat word found. */
#define scrsExtraSpaces                  12  /* Too many spaces for context.*/
#define scrsMissingSpace                 13  /* Too few space(s) between words or sentences. */
#define scrsInitialNumeral				 14  /* Word starts with numeral & soFlagInitialNumeral set */

/* Spell Options bitfield definitions */
#define soSuggestFromUserDict    0x0001 /* Scan Udr's as well as Mdr(s) */
#define soIgnoreAllCaps          0x0002 /* Ignore a word if all upppercase.*/
#define soIgnoreMixedDigits      0x0004 /* Ignore word if has any numbers in it.*/
#define soIgnoreRomanNumerals    0x0008 /* Ignore word composed of all roman numerals.*/
#define soFindUncappedSentences  0x0010 /* Flag sentences which don't start with a cap.*/
#define soFindMissingSpaces      0x0020 /* Find missing spaces between words/sentences. */
#define soFindRepeatWord         0x0040 /* CSAPI to flag repeated words. */
#define soFindExtraSpaces        0x0080 /* CSAPI to flag extra spaces between words.*/
#define soFindSpacesBeforePunc   0x0100 /* CSAPI to flag space preceeding certain 
                                           punc.  ex. (the ) is flagged.
                                           the following chars are flagged.
                                           ) ] } > , ; % . ? !
                                        */
#define soFindSpacesAfterPunc    0x0200 /* CSAPI to flag space after certain 
                                           punc. ex. ( the) is flagged.  The
                                           following chars are flagged.
                                           ( [ { $
                                        */
#define soRateSuggestions        0x0400
   /* All suggestions returned should be given some scaled value 
      corresponding to liklihood of being correct alternative.
      Scale is 1..255, 255 most likely correction and 1 least likely
   */
#define soFindInitialNumerals	 0x0800 /* Flag words starting with number(s) */
#define soReportUDHits           0x1000 /* Report (via scrsNoErrorsUDHit) where
										*  user dict was used during verification
										*/
#define soQuickSuggest           0x2000 /* Don't use typo suggest code (Soft-Art only) */
#define soUseAllOpenUdr          0x4000 /* Automatically use all udr's opened
										* after this option is set, or all opened udr's
										* with mdr's opened after this option is set.
										* This option does not allow exclusion dicts to
										* be edited.
										* (HM only)
										*/
#define soSwapMdr                0x8000 /* Keep the most recent 2 mdr's around.
										* swap between them instead of actually closing
										* and reopening mdr's.
										* (HM only)
										*/
#define soSglStepSugg           0x10000 /* Break after each suggestion task for faster
										* return of control to the application.
										* (HM only)
										*/
